Why should you avoid pumping the brakes when driving a tanker vehicle?

a.It wears out the brake pads faster
b.Each brake release and reapplication can worsen liquid surge effects
c.It uses more air pressure
d.Pumping brakes is actually recommended for tankers

Explanation

Pumping the brakes on a tanker should be avoided because each time you release and reapply the brakes, the liquid surge can push the vehicle forward during the release phase. Instead, apply steady brake pressure to maintain control.

About the CDL Exam

The CDL (Commercial Driver License) exam tests your knowledge of commercial driving rules, safety procedures, and vehicle operation. You must score 80% or higher to pass the written knowledge test. The exam covers general knowledge, air brakes, combination vehicles, and various endorsements.
